1、类别变量:只是用数字来代表事物或对事物进行分类,数字没有任何数值意义,只表明类别。 2、顺序变量:表明类别的大小或某种属性的多少,数字仅表示等级并不表示某种属性的真正量或绝对值。 3、等距变量:数字存在大小关系。无绝对零点,但存在相对零点。有相等单位。 4、比率变量:有相等单位和绝对零点,可以知道事物之间...
val i:Int=0 前面的val表示后面是个变量声明语句,接着是“变量名:变量类型”的格式声明,而不是常见的“变量类型 变量名”这种格式。至于后面的分号,则看该代码行后面是否还有其它语句,如果变量声明完毕直接回车换行,那么后面无需带分号;如果没有回车换行,而是添加其它语句,那么变量声明语句要带上分号。 另外一个重...
4.字符类型事实上是一个16位无符号的整数,0---48,A--65,a---97 3.基本类型间的转换 除boolean外的七种,类型从小到大依次为byte short int long float double char 3.1两种方式: 3.1.1自动类型转换:从小类型到大类型 3.1.2强制类型转换:从大类型到小类型,有可能溢出,也有可能丢失精度转换时在变量前加(...
联合体(Union):联合体是在同一内存位置存储不同类型数据的结构,但一次只能存储一种类型。如同多功能笔,一头可写,一头可擦。通过这些基本变量类型的学习,你可以更好地理解编程的原理和逻辑,为进一步的学习打下坚实的基础。加油!💪0 0 发表评论 发表 作者最近动态 七安Melody会彤彤 2024-11-22 变形金刚主题壁纸...
在上面的例子中,age 和 pi 都叫做变量。这两个变量分别存储年龄数据和圆周率近似值数据。 这两个变量的类型分别是整形int,和浮点数类型double。 这两个变量分别存储了整数18,和实数3.14159。 它们可以用下图表示: 2 基础类型 C++提供了一些基础类型(内置类型)。比如 int, long ,float ,char ,bool 等。 不同类...
基本类型-八大基本数据类型 4.基本类型的定义 语法: 数据类型 变量名=变量值(“=”为赋值运算符) 定义布尔类型的变量 boolearn aa=true 定义整形 byte bb=1; short cc=2; int dd =3; long ee =4; 3. 定义浮点型 float ff=3.14f;//小数默认被提升为double类型(8个字节),这个过程叫类型向上自动提升,...
(一)4值变量有4种,wire,reg,logic,integer。 首先咱们来看一看4值变量中最常见的wire和reg,关于他们俩有一个很常见的问题,就是为什么过程赋值(就是always块)中用reg,并且要用非阻塞赋值(<=,后面都写nonblocking赋值了,方便一点)。而连续赋值(就是assign语句,blocking赋值)中就要用阻塞赋值(=)。
基本数据类型 C++的基本数据类型,可以分为整型(int)、实型(float)、双精度型(double)、字符型(char)、布尔型(bool)和无值型(void)等。在这里的介绍顺序与书中不同,将按照常量和变量两大类来划分,以求更清晰的总结与分辨。 常量...
1.cpp变量类型 变量实际上是存储空间的名称,cpp中每个变量都有指定的类型,类型决定变量存储的大小和布局,该范围内的值都可以存储在内存中,运算符可以作用在变量上。 变量名可以是字母 数字 下划线组成,必须以字母或下划线开头。区分大小写 几种基本的变量类型: ...